Build a Secure Logging Server with syslog-ng
A nice 2-part tutorial on how to build a secure logging server with syslog-ng and various other open source packages. From Enterprise Networking Planet:
Managing Linux system and application logging is important and a bit tricksy. You want to capture important information, not bales of noise. You need to be able to find what you want in your logs without making it your life's work. The venerable old syslogd has served nobly for many years, but it's not quite up to meeting more complex needs. For this we have the next-generation Linux logger, syslog-ng.
